Ordinals
beta
Sat 731931307215206
decimal
146386.1307215206
degree
0°146386′1234″1307215206‴
percentile
34.853871810491945%
name
iqyegvpoopv
cycle
0
epoch
0
period
72
block
146386
offset
1307215206
timestamp
2011-09-22 05:08:38 UTC
rarity
common
prev
next